Annie Foster has joined IPG
Health as group director, social media creative. Foster will partner with the network's engagement team to use social media and influencers to enhance brand campaigns.
Previously, she worked with Meta on brands such as Bobbi Brown and Roman. Before that, she also held creative director roles in healthcare advertising.
Foster is charged with expanding IPG Health’s Influencer ID offering, which combines healthcare expertise and customer engagement strategy. The offering provides a tailored HIPAA compliant end-to-end solution for healthcare brands.
“Annie has a distinct background. She has a strong health and pharma base — having grown up in the pharma agency world — and then expanded her horizons at Meta. She knows what great looks like in social/influencer marketing across verticals and across agencies, not just in pharma,” said Dana Maiman, IPG Health CEO.

“Social — and by extension mobile — is a distinct medium. Building social advertising creative requires a deep understanding of its language — both visual and verbal. It’s not just about getting the specs right, it’s about building campaigns that connect authentically because they are well-suited both to the audience and the medium. Creatives at IPG Health understand this,” added Foster.
